Output 305efac5fd351dbf4869b2db79f1a1c6ccf56c52ef052abb207410b8248645be:4

value
93626
script pubkey
OP_0 OP_PUSHBYTES_20 cc38026a5f440349478c41ccdb824ec1147ff03e
address
tb1qesuqy6jlgsp5j3uvg8xdhqjwcy28lup7frglzy
transaction
305efac5fd351dbf4869b2db79f1a1c6ccf56c52ef052abb207410b8248645be
confirmations
20789
spent
true